Description
This property is no longer available to rent or to buy. This description is from February 23, 2024
NEW PRICE! Serenity awaits you with stunning water views & soothing fountain sounds while you relax on the spacious screened-in porch. This immaculate 4 BR/3.5 BA home is the perfect combination of luxury & privacy. Some amazing features include: white oak hardwoods throughout main fl; gourmet kitchen with dbl ovens & walk-in pantry; 1st fl owners suite; 2 flex areas on 2nd fl for offices, playroom, theater, or a gym; 3rd fl unfinished bonus space; fully A/C crawlspace; and freshly finished garage floors!

6805 Mactavish Way, Raleigh, NC 27613 is a 4 bedroom, 4 bathroom, 4,334 sqft single-family home built in 2013. This property is not currently available for sale. 6805 Mactavish Way was last sold on Aug 4, 2021 for $875,000 (1% higher than the asking price of $870,000). The current Trulia Estimate for 6805 Mactavish Way is $1,124,100.
